Overview:
Visa Consulting & Analytics (VCA) helps Visa clients—including financial institutions and merchants—achieve measurable business results. Leveraging expertise in strategy, data analytics, brand management, marketing, operations, and economics, VCA addresses clients' most critical business challenges.
The North America Consulting Practice provides advisory and solution services to U.S. issuers. By combining deep expertise in banking, payments, and analytics, the team helps clients advance strategic priorities, accelerate growth, and improve profitability. VCA delivers a broad range of consulting solutions focused on areas such as profitability enhancement, growth strategy, customer experience, digital payments, and risk management.
We are seeking a Director to join the Community segment and help deliver high-impact consulting engagements for Visa clients across North America. This individual will be responsible for both selling consulting services and leading the delivery and implementation of solutions for U.S. financial institutions and issuing banks. The role focuses on driving sustainable, profitable growth while strengthening Visa's position as a trusted strategic partner.
Typical engagements include market expansion, profitability optimization, customer segmentation, growth strategy, product development, program launches, customer acquisition, lifecycle management, retention, and portfolio enhancement.
